Book excerpt: For over 10 years the European Community has strived to develop suitable and proportionate answers to the phenomenon of convergence in its audiovisual regulatory policy. This article outlines the regulatory process at an EU level since the early 1980s as far as media, telecommunications and Information Society services are concerned, and analyses some of the most relevant policy papers specifically related to the adoption of the EC legal framework for the media in the digital age, before focusing on the preparatory phase leading up to the adoption of the Commission proposal for a Directive on Audiovisual Media Services, issued in December 2005. In addition, the core of this proposal for a revised Television without Frontiers Directive, i.e. the extension of its scope to cover new media services provided in a non-linear manner and the introduction of a graduated regime of regulation with a lighter-touch approach in view of such services, is presented along with the main lines of debate among stakeholders.

Book excerpt: This book describes and critically addresses the innovations and shifts made in the revision of the Audiovisual Media Services Directive (AVMSD) adopted by the European Parliament and Council in 2018. Reflecting on European Union regulation and policy practice in all its Member States, the book’s unique approach places in-depth case study topics against the broader theoretical background. Taking a Europe-wide angle, an international team of authors focuses on key aspects of the AVMSD: the expansion of its scope to include video-sharing-platforms such as YouTube; the update of the rules for commercial communications; the first attempt for harmonized, minimal requirements at EU level regarding transparency of media ownership; new rules to ensure that video-on-demand services offer, invest in, and prioritise European content; the obligation on television distributors and smart TV manufacturers to pass on broadcasters’ signal without any interference, alteration or modification; and, the formalisation and consolidation of new forms of collaboration among national regulatory authorities. Book excerpt: Audiovisual Media Services Directive (AVMSD), which provided a legal framework for traditional TV broadcasts and on-demand services, was revised in November 2018 in order to align with new developments in audiovisual technologies and on audiovisual markets. To facilitate the implementation of the AVMSD, this study looks at regulatory and business practices relating to three topics included for the first time in the EU media framework: video-sharing platforms (VSPs), media ownership and transparency, and signal integrity. Concerning VSPs, the study looks at the extent to which VSPs can and do take measures to protect minors and the public, as envisaged by the AVMSD. It also looks at developments in implementation at Member State level and the transnational dimension. The media ownership and transparency part explores approaches across the EU to constraining media concentration and promoting transparency, the extent to which current rules are sufficient and enforced, the related best practices, and whether action should be taken at EU or national level. The signal integrity part discusses the prevalence of problems with signal integrity and the conditions that need to be met for the successful implementation of the Directive.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: "The European audiovisual industry is one of the most dynamic markets in the European Union. The Audiovisual Media Services Directive is the bedrock of the EU's audiovisual and media policies. It regulates diverse aspects for providers of television broadcasting and on-demand services and entered into force in December 2007. Due to the volatility of a market facing convergence of media and important policy choices, for instance whether to allow product placement, Member States have struggled with the transposition of this Directive. This completely new commentary employs an innovative approach: Based on English translations, the study systematically examines the national implementing measures of the future 28 Member States (including Croatia). It sets out, article-by-article, the original provisions contained in the Directive before analysing domestic transpositions. National measures are grouped in order to reveal similarities and differences and examined for compliance with the Directive. This comparative perspective contributes to the discussions on reforms of the Directive or the EU's approach to new media services."--

Book excerpt: The current ongoing revision of the EC's Television without Frontiers (TVwF) Directive clearly raises major questions for the future of the regulation of linear and non-linear services. However, it also gives rise to reflection concerning the Council of Europe's European Convention on Transfrontier Television (ECTT), a parallel regulatory instrument concerning cross-border broadcasting. At a time of major transformation of the European legal instruments which are applied to broadcasting and new audiovisual services, this new report from the European Audiovisual Observatory takes stock of recent and current problem areas in broadcasting regulation in the light of the challenges these will raise for the new extended regulation. The report analyses issues of the practical application of the TVwF Directive and the ECTT in their current form. It also raises the question of the future cohabitation of the two instruments following the completed revision of the TVwF Directive, not forgetting that there will clearly be a period where the two instruments will be "out of phase" with each other.

Book excerpt: The study provides the European Commission (Directorate General for Communications Networks, Content & Technology) with the tools and information required for the monitoring and evaluation of the impact of Union and national level measures for the promotion, distribution and production of European works and independent productions in television programmes and the production of and access to European works in on-demand services. The study updates a 2011 report by capturing changes in the legislative and economic audiovisual landscape between 2011 and 2016. Furthermore, the study brings together the data collected from Member States fulfilling their reporting obligation on the application of Article 13 of the AVMS Directive for the period 2011-2014, and on the application of Articles 16 and 17 of the AVMS Directive for the period 2013-2014. The study covers the legislative measures which have been adopted by Member States in respect of linear broadcasting and on-demand audiovisual media services examining the methods and periodicity for the collection of data by competent authorities in order to monitor the application of the Art. 13, 16 & 17 of the AVMS Directive. It provides examples of methods to ensure the prominence of European works in on-demand service catalogues and evidence of correlation between prominent works and audience demand. The study includes a description and analysis of the market for audiovisual works in the European Union, analysing the production and the distribution side in terms of number of businesses, employment and potential drivers of change. It also includes an analysis of the content offer on both linear broadcasting and on-demand services. For the year 2016, the study analyses the content broadcast by 54 channels in 11 Member States and the catalogues of 50 non-linear service providers in 6 Member States. Finally, the study provides a set of performance indicators in view of carrying out future monitoring and assessment activities at periodical intervals and it assesses how the performance indicators and operational procedures shall evolve in the context of the new AVMSD legislative proposal adopted by the European Commission on 25 May 2016.
